Forge FC Enhances Partnership with CSMRO, Naming Them as the Club’s Newest Development Club
Forge FC is proud to announce the expansion of its partnership with Club de Soccer Mont-Royal Outremont (CS MRO), solidifying CS MRO’s status as Forge FC’s newest Development Club. Building on the successful partnership established in 2023, both organizations are excited to take the next step in their collaboration, further strengthening player development pathways and growing the game at the youth level.
CS MRO, a prestigious youth soccer club based in Mont-Royal and Outremont, Quebec, boasts a rich history and a diverse player base of over 2,000 youth athletes. The club has established itself as a leader in youth development, making it a natural fit for Forge FC’s long-term vision of fostering elite soccer talent.
“The success of our relationship with CS MRO over the past few seasons has been incredible, and we’re thrilled to enhance our partnership by making them our newest Development Club,” said Kyriakos Selaidopoulos, Director of Youth Football at Forge FC. “This next step allows us to build on our shared philosophy of player development, and we look forward to continuing to work together to create opportunities for young athletes to reach their full potential.”
The expanded collaboration will continue to focus on developing coaches and players from U13 to U18, covering both boys’ and girls’ programs. Forge FC will provide further technical leadership and support to CS MRO’s coaching staff, ensuring a unified and professional approach to player development across both organizations while opening a direct player pathway into the Forge FC system.

This strengthened partnership marks a significant milestone in Forge FC’s commitment to developing young Canadian talent and reinforcing its presence within the Quebec soccer landscape. By deepening its ties with CS MRO, Forge FC continues to invest in the future of the sport and inspire the next generation of soccer stars.

CS MRO joins the long-time Forge FC youth club, Sigma FC, as a development club. Additional announcements are expected in the near future, recognizing Forge FC Partner Clubs from across the Greater Hamilton area and beyond.
